When you apply Online promotion such as submitting free articles to ePublishers who are crying for them, you spend around an hour or so on each article that can be recycled many times. The actual time of sending it out is a few minutes.

Even if you need to mail your product, you still will have to spend less time and money.

Using email to offer and sell your products reduces your dependence on other sales channels such asrepparttar brick and mortar stores, traveling to give talks, and writing "round file" press releases.

When you market Online, you eliminaterepparttar 124938 middle man who can take a hefty percentage of your profit--up to 90%.

My motto is: If someone else who takes a commission can't sell at least 10 times as many products as I can, I don't need them."

5. Reduce your marketing time because email communication is short, fast, and gets torepparttar 124939 point quickly.

You don't have to spend time buying stamps, logos, special envelopes and stationery. You do need to keep track of every customer, subscriber and Web visitor. Be alert to collect every person's email address when you meet and greet. Place each one in a categorized file, so you can laser target messages to one audience at a time.

If you sell books on your Web site, you can look like Barnes and Noble reaching thousands, even tens of thousands each day. Your visitor will have an easier time to find your product because you offer only a few on your site.
